Output dd30fb7a61e4282e0df507f0ddea1912affbd068f38956e83a44b85cd091203d:35

value
1559900000
script pubkey
OP_0 OP_PUSHBYTES_20 3d6f58c01d033819f2064947ddade51674aae186
address
ltc1q84h43sqaqvupnusxf9ramt09ze624cvxevc0ca
transaction
dd30fb7a61e4282e0df507f0ddea1912affbd068f38956e83a44b85cd091203d
spent
true